Get set for snow and cold temps

January 17, 2019 By Bob Hague

Winter weather is headed towards parts of the state which have yet to see much of it. There’s a winter storm watch for Friday night into Saturday for much of southern Wisconsin.

Snowfall amounts could range from 2 to 5 inches in the southwest to 4 to 8 inches in the southeast.

Snow will be followed by bitterly cold temperatures for the weekend, with overnight lows below zero across most of northern Wisconsin, and dangerous wind chills.
